What a Character: Bullying

For grades K-6 | 60 minutes | Up to 300 students | $250

George is determined to be cool this school year. If he learns enough putdowns and shuns the kids who are “different,” he’s sure he can become popular. But that’s before Zach shows him the effect that bullying–even the verbal kind–can have on other people. Finally, George (and your students) discover what bullying looks like, and how to stop it. Plus, audience volunteers get to come onstage to act out stories about kindness!

Topics covered during our interactive assembly include:

  • What is a bully?
  • How can you stop a bully if he/ she is picking on someone you know?
  • What are some ways to find help if you’re the one being bullied?
  • How can showing kindness make a difference?
